Five steps to healing your relationship with your mum

Steps to healing your relationship with your mum (Photo: iStock)

An ideal family is one in which all relationships are healthy and thriving. Fathers would have healthy relationships with their sons, mothers would have no problems bonding with their daughters, and basically everyone would get along peacefully.

But as we know, things don't always turn out the way we expect - that's life. Most of the problems we see stem from broken relationships within the family, especially the parent-child relationship.
